您当前的位置:首页 > 常见问答

mysql远程连接数据库的最佳工具推荐

作者:远客网络

要远程连接MySQL数据库,可以使用以下工具:

  1. MySQL客户端:MySQL自带的命令行客户端可以用于远程连接数据库。在命令行中输入以下命令即可连接到远程数据库:
mysql -h <host> -P <port> -u <username> -p

其中,<host>是数据库主机的IP地址或域名,<port>是数据库服务的端口号(默认为3306),<username>是数据库的用户名,-p参数表示需要输入密码进行身份验证。

  1. Navicat:Navicat是一款功能强大的数据库管理工具,支持多种数据库,包括MySQL。它提供了直观的用户界面,可以轻松地进行远程连接数据库,并进行数据库管理、查询和操作。

  2. HeidiSQL:HeidiSQL是一款免费开源的MySQL客户端工具,支持远程连接数据库。它提供了图形化界面,方便用户进行数据库管理和操作。

  3. MySQL Workbench:MySQL Workbench是MySQL官方推出的一款数据库管理工具,支持远程连接MySQL数据库。它提供了丰富的功能,包括数据库设计、查询、备份和恢复等。

  4. DBeaver:DBeaver是一款通用的数据库管理工具,支持多种数据库,包括MySQL。它提供了图形化界面和强大的功能,可以进行远程连接数据库、执行SQL查询和管理数据库对象。

这些工具都可以通过指定数据库的主机地址、端口号、用户名和密码等信息来实现远程连接数据库,并提供了丰富的功能和操作界面,方便用户进行数据库管理和查询。选择合适的工具,根据自己的需求和使用习惯进行远程连接数据库。

要远程连接MySQL数据库,可以使用MySQL的命令行工具或者图形化界面工具。

  1. MySQL的命令行工具:使用命令行工具可以通过在终端中输入命令来连接MySQL数据库。确保已经安装了MySQL服务器,并且服务器已经启动。然后,在终端中输入以下命令连接到远程MySQL数据库:
mysql -h hostname -P port -u username -p

其中,hostname是数据库服务器的主机名或者IP地址,port是数据库服务器的端口号,默认为3306,username是连接数据库的用户名,-p表示需要输入密码进行验证。

例如,要连接到主机名为example.com,端口号为3306,用户名为root的MySQL数据库,可以使用以下命令:

mysql -h example.com -P 3306 -u root -p

然后,输入密码进行验证后,即可成功连接到远程MySQL数据库。

  1. 图形化界面工具:除了使用命令行工具,还可以使用图形化界面的工具来连接MySQL数据库。常用的图形化界面工具有Navicat、MySQL Workbench等。这些工具提供了直观的界面,可以通过填写连接信息来远程连接MySQL数据库。通常需要填写的连接信息包括主机名、端口号、用户名、密码等。

例如,使用Navicat连接远程MySQL数据库的步骤如下:

  • 打开Navicat工具;
  • 点击菜单栏的“连接”选项,选择“MySQL”;
  • 在连接设置中填写主机名、端口号、用户名和密码;
  • 点击“连接”按钮,即可连接到远程MySQL数据库。

通过上述两种方式,你可以方便地远程连接MySQL数据库,并进行数据库操作。

要远程连接MySQL数据库,可以使用以下工具:

  1. MySQL命令行客户端:MySQL自带的命令行工具可以通过命令行远程连接数据库。确保已经安装了MySQL命令行客户端。然后,使用以下命令连接到远程MySQL服务器:
mysql -h <服务器IP地址> -u <用户名> -p

其中,<服务器IP地址>是远程MySQL服务器的IP地址,<用户名>是要连接到MySQL服务器的用户名,-p表示需要输入密码。

  1. Navicat for MySQL:Navicat是一款功能强大的数据库管理工具,可以用于远程连接MySQL数据库。下载并安装Navicat for MySQL。然后,打开Navicat,在连接窗口中填写以下信息:主机名(远程MySQL服务器的IP地址)、端口号(默认为3306)、用户名和密码。点击连接按钮即可连接到远程MySQL数据库。

  2. MySQL Workbench:MySQL Workbench是MySQL官方推出的图形化管理工具,也可以用于远程连接MySQL数据库。下载并安装MySQL Workbench。然后,打开MySQL Workbench,在连接窗口中填写以下信息:连接名称、主机名(远程MySQL服务器的IP地址)、端口号(默认为3306)、用户名和密码。点击连接按钮即可连接到远程MySQL数据库。

以上是常用的远程连接MySQL数据库的工具。根据自己的需求和喜好选择适合自己的工具进行远程连接。无论使用哪种工具,都需要确保远程MySQL服务器已经启用远程连接,并且防火墙配置允许外部访问MySQL服务的端口。